Job Description
- Job title: Senior DSEAR Engineer - TEMP - Nationally
- Engagement type: Inside IR35
- Location: Nationally (Epsom / London)
- Start Date: ASAP
- End date: Ongoing
- Hours per week: 40
- Charge Rate per hour: £50-£65 dependant on experience/role/client
- Qualification required for this role: Chartered Engineer
We have an extensive backlog of DSEAR work (Dangerous Substances and Explosive Atmospheres Regulations) across the UK in multiple markets. Bring your skills to the mix as a Senior DSEAR Engineer, youll play a critical role in supporting our engineering teams with a vital function on Transformational Programmes for critical UK infrastructure with opportunities to work on iconic engineering projects at home and abroad.
We specialise in all aspects of engineering, within multiple challenging and engaging sectors such as Water, Aviation, Defence, Energy, Cities & Development and Education. We continue to provide industry-leading engineering solutions right through the project lifecycle, with value added through client-side support as well as construction phases. If being a part of a team with a passion for this industry is for you then we would love to talk to you.
Your Purpose
- Lead a team to undertake technical design work following relevant design standards and codes, and to high-quality levels.
- Prepare briefs, scopes of work, and input into bid proposals.
- Successfully manage time and budgets to key project milestones and programmes.
- Work closely with teams in the UK and overseas to deliver integrated design solutions.
- Adhere to quality assurance standards in design.
What you can bring
- Chartered Engineer, ideally with training in hazardous area determination and risk assessment from a recognised body.
- Experience of the role of leading DSEAR in design delivery, ideally within the water industry, or a related process industry.
- Strong technical knowledge of the application of DSEAR, including risk assessment and area classification in accordance with EN (phone number removed) and IP 15.
- Strong understanding of DSEAR legislation, ATEX directives and CDM
